Everyone knows the benefits of focusing on the right carbs when dieting. However, it isn't always easy. Now for the first time, you can use this unique point-counting system and lose weight forever. The Glycaemic index (GI) is one the hottest topics in dieting today, yet even using that to shed kilos can be difficult. However, with the GI point system there's no stress and no complicated calculations. Each food item has been given a points simply add up the points of your favourite foods each day and off you go! And it's flexible - even if you are a bit naughty now and then, you can still lose weight and get healthy. The GI diet is not about avoiding foods - it's about balancing your meals, and it is designed to keep you full for longer so you don't feel you're on a diet.

About the author

Azmina Govindji

33 books3 followers
Azmina Govindji is an award-winning registered dietitian, consultant nutritionist, international speaker and bestselling author. She is a media spokesperson for the British Dietetic Association and contributes expert advice on the NHS Choices website.

Azmina is known for her appearances on shows such as This Morning, The Wright Stuff, The One Show, BBC News, the Victoria Derbyshire show and BBC’s Inside the Factory. She is often quoted in newspapers and magazines, and has written over a dozen books on weight management and diabetes.

She is the nutrition expert for Simply Vegan magazine and a member of Holland & Barrett’s Healthy magazine expert panel and appeared as expert dietitian on Sky News digital and BBC News digital Veganuary videos.
